Default Mandatory Cell check on multy page workbook

On 1 Jan, 16:22, "Per Jessen" wrote:
Hi Alex
Considering the comments from Dave your own code can work like this.

Private Sub Workbook_BeforeSave(ByVal SaveAsUI As Boolean, _
* * * * * * Cancel As Boolean)

' this will check that all green areas are filled in

Dim Msg As String
Dim checkCells As Range
Dim c As Range

Select Case ActiveSheet.Name
Case "Amendment"
* * Set checkCells = Sheets("Amendment").Range("c6,k6,c7,k7,d45")
* * For Each c In checkCells
* * * * If IsEmpty(c) = True Then Cancel = True
* * Next
* * If Cancel = True Then
* * * * Msg = MsgBox("Attention ALL GREEN AREAS must be filled in prior to
saving. PLease go back and check your work", vbOKOnly, "ATTENTION
REQUIRED!!")
* * End If
Case "Starter"
* * Set checkCells = _
* * Sheets("Starter").Range("c6,k6,c7,k7,c11,c14,c15,c 16,c17,c18,c20,e20,e21,e2*2,a26,b26,c26,d26,a30,k2 9,k30,l30,n30,o30,q30,r30,k31,l31,m31,n31,o31,p31, q*31,r31,d45")
* * For Each c In checkCells
* * * * If IsEmpty(c) = True Then Cancel = True
* * Next
* * If Cancel = True Then
* * * * Msg = MsgBox("Attention ALL GREEN AREAS must be filled in prior to
saving. PLease go back and check your work", vbOKOnly, "ATTENTION
REQUIRED!!")
* * End If
Case "Leaver"
* * Set checkCells =
Sheets("leaver").Range("c6,k6,c7,k7,c37,l37,c38,d4 1,n41,d45")
* * For Each c In checkCells
* * * * If IsEmpty(c) = True Then Cancel = True
* * Next
* * If Cancel = True Then
* * * * Msg = MsgBox("Attention ALL GREEN AREAS must be filled in prior to
saving. PLease go back and check your work", vbOKOnly, "ATTENTION
REQUIRED!!")
* * End If
End Select
End Sub
